Re-engagement emails present unique CAN-SPAM challenges that standard marketing emails don't face. These campaigns target subscribers who haven't engaged recently, making them statistically more likely to mark emails as spam if compliance elements feel intrusive or confusing. The 8-Dimension Email Quality Framework identifies Deliverability and Structural Compliance as two of the eight critical dimensions, and re-engagement emails must score exceptionally high on both to reach inboxes. Common mistakes include burying unsubscribe links in footer clutter, using misleading subject lines that reference past engagement, and failing to include proper sender identification that dormant subscribers might not remember. Professional services firms face additional complexity because their re-engagement emails often reference specific services or consultations from months ago, requiring careful balance between personalization and compliance clarity. Even minor violations can trigger spam complaints that damage sender reputation across all future campaigns, not just the re-engagement sequence.

What are best practices for re engagement emails in professional services?+
Start with segmentation: re engage only inactive contacts who previously engaged with your content or services. Use a subject line that acknowledges the gap without being aggressive, such as We have missed you or New insights since we last connected. Include one clear, non-pushy call to action, like reviewing a recent case study or scheduling a brief conversation. Reference a specific previous interaction to show you remember the relationship. Professional services firms should avoid aggressive urgency tactics or discount-heavy language, which damage trust. The EQS framework prioritizes Relevance and Value Proposition in re engagement scenarios, and compliant emails that score 8 or higher typically see re engagement open rates 25 to 35 percent higher than generic win-back campaigns.
How long should a re engagement email be for professional services?+
Keep it concise: 50 to 150 words in the body, with a single clear paragraph leading to the CTA. Professional services audiences prefer efficiency and respect for their time. A brief, honest message outperforms lengthy explanations of why you disappeared. Your subject line should be 40 to 60 characters to avoid truncation on mobile devices, and the entire email should load and render properly on phone screens.
